Just drove around South Delta here a bit and the micro climates today are pretty crazy. I just measured 5 cm here in East Ladner, meanwhile if you drive about 2 minutes South down towards Boundary Bay/Tsawwassen it turns to wet snow fast and then rain/snow mix and no snow on the ground by highway 17. Then i drove into Ladner village and the west side of Ladner has maybe 1-2 cm at most but as you head back East towards hwy 17A/East Ladner the roads become completely covered fast. Now that I'm back home the temp just shot up to 0.8c as the wind just picked up from the East and its now turned to a rain/snow mix. I'm just happy I managed to pick up 5 cm before the change over :lol:
